Strength performance Valve strength performance refers to the ability of the valve to withstand medium pressure. Valves are mechanical products subject to internal pressure and must therefore have sufficient strength and rigidity to ensure long term use without rupture or deformation. Sealing performance Valve sealing performance refers to the sealing of the valve to prevent the leakage of the media capacity, it is the valve of the most important technical performance indicators. There are three parts of the valve seal: opening and closing parts and valve seat seal between the two contacts; filler and the stem and packing box with the Department of the valve body and the valve cover connections. One of the leaks is called leakage before, which is commonly referred to as lax, it will affect the ability of the valve to cut off the medium. For cut-off valves, internal leakage is not allowed. After the two leaks called leakage, that is, the medium leaked from the valve to the valve. Leakage will result in material loss, pollute the environment, serious accidents will result. For flammable, toxic or radioactive media, leakage is even more not allowed, so the valve must have a reliable sealing performance. Opening and Closing Force and Opening and Closing Moment The opening and closing force and opening and closing torque refer to the force or torque that must be applied when the valve is opened or closed. Close the valve, the need to make the opening and closing seat and the seat between the two sealing surface to form a certain seal than the pressure, but also to overcome the valve stem and packing between the stem and nut thread between the stem end of the bearing and Other friction parts of the friction, which must impose a certain closing force and closing torque, the valve opening and closing process, the required opening and closing force and opening and closing torque is changing, the maximum value is in the closure of the final instantaneous or open The initial instant. When designing and manufacturing valves, they should strive to reduce their closing force and closing torque. Opening and closing speed Opening and closing speed is used to complete the valve to open or close the action required to represent. General opening and closing of the valve speed is not strictly required, but some conditions on the opening and closing speed has special requirements, if any requirements quickly open or close to prevent accidents, and some require slow closure to prevent water hammer and so on, This should be considered when choosing the type of valve.
